EducationEducation Beyond Certificate by menzo4u(op): 3:01am On Nov 27, 2015
EDUCATION BEYOND CERTIFICATE::::

It is hightime we gave another definition to the term "education". To some people, education borders on going to school, acquiring degrees and working for a company to earn a salary at the end of the month.

My dear readers, education goes beyond acquiring certificate, "we must redefine education"....

Education teaches you about how to make rules, break rules, and challenge an ongoing trend, school teaches you about how to follow rules, live by the rules, and live an ongoing trend unchallenged, thereby limiting that power of creativity in you.

Have you witnessed a scenerio whereby you asked a Maths lecturer about how he arrived at a certain formula, and he tells you "that is how it is done"?, and mind you, if you do anything contrary...you FAIL his exam, therefore you must follow the rules.

A truly educated man is he who has developed the faculties of his mind to follow his passion, find solutions where there are problems without following the rules, but creates his own ways through his deep imagination to achieve his dreams.

Checkout most of the world's richest people today, they are mostly school dropouts. Do you think they are not educated because they are school dropouts? Far from it! They are really educated in their own ways, they simply decided to build their own dreams rather than allow themselves to be hired by other people to builld theirs.

So many people spend their precious years in school only to end up acquiring cerificate NOT education.

Examples of these people include:

1) * People who don't practise what they learn in school before graduation.

As a student of Computer Science, how many codes have you written that worked? Have you been able to (in reality) write a program that solves the problem of an organisation?

As a student of Business Administration, how many businesses have you started? How many times have you exprienced failiure in business, and rise again?

So, are you putting what you are learning in school into practice?

The school will not give or teach you these orientation but education will.

2)*People who have no SKILLS...successful people don't depend on the government of their country to provide jobs for them. A truly educated person has skills, an uneducated fellow can only boast of his certificate without any skills to back it up.

True education lies in the abilty to solve problems with the skills you possess.....what are you waiting for? STAND UP NOW, do not procrastinate, learn a skill you are passionate about.

What am I advocating?
This writeup is not in anyway articulated to undermine the importance of schooling...Going to school is very important but our mindset about school is what we are advised to change.

TRUE EDUCATION PREPARES YOU TO SURVIVE WITHOUT YOUR CERTIFICATE.

PoliticsWhen Things Go Wrong; Change The Plan Not The Goal by menzo4u(op): 3:24am On Nov 08, 2015
*WHEN THINGS GO WRONG; CHANGE THE PLAN NOT THE GOAL*

Reading this piece alone shows that you have a goal in life, because only someone who really has a goal will be interested in reading anything that has to do with GOAL. So read on!

I am a passionate fan of the adage that says "man proposes, God disposes". Many motivational books have been written on the importance of planning to success in life, but it is not that most of us do not have plans, but the issue is that things just don't always go as planned sometimes.

As a fervent lover of the ENTREPRENEURSHIP "gospel", I will like to channel this article to that line.

It is your goal to create businesses, employ people, change lives, have a foundational institution in your name that gives to the charity homes.
In order to achieve the set goals, you make a life plan, and due to circumstances, the plan fails. Don't quit, don't give up, don't change the goal, just change the plan.

What have you set out to achieve in life (goal) that you decided to change or give up simply because things didn't go as planned? All you need to do is to change the plan, not the goal.

The plan "B" factor is all we need in ensuring we achieve our goals...just have an alternative plan always.

“It is not the strongest of the species that survive, not the most intelligent, but the one most responsive to change.” Charles Darwin

So whatever our goals may be, let's create a flexible plan that can easily adapt to changes in case things go wrong....change the plan not the goal.

CareerThe ACTORS Of Tomorrow: A Motivational Piece. by menzo4u(op): 7:50pm On Nov 04, 2015
The ACTORS of tomorrow

There is this inner force that keeps stopping us from achieving what we are set to accomplish in life. Many people today would have actualise their dreams and rule their world to a great and enviable extent if not for this inner force that remains their obstacle. This inner force is what I term "tomorrow".

Tomorrow is the word often used by the people who are not ready to act on their dreams, I also call it procrastination. Have you ever imagined when you see a signboard in a shop on which it is written "no credit today, come tomorrow"? Do you know what this ironically means? The shop owner knows that tomorrow will never come.

Reflecting this on our lives as people generally, there are many beautiful ideas on our mind, there is this VISION in our imagination begging for action everyday but most of us are actors of tomorrow, not actors of today.

Each time this door of opportuntiy is standing before us waiting to be opened, the actor of tommorow says "I will do it tommorow", when great possibilites opens arm to embrace them, the actors of tommorrow say "let's put it till tomorrow".

Unfortunately, until it comes to a day, that day that the opportunity will be gone and the actors of tommorrow will turn back to blame their friends, the government of their country, their parents...and the blaming continues just because they never acted at the right time.

The actors of tomorrow would have been celebrated by the world like Folorunsho Alakija, they would have set records like Usain Bolt, achieve their dreams like Mikel Obi, inspire the world like Professor Wole Soyinka, rule their own world like Aliko Dangote, and been role models to their generation like Seun Osewa of Nairaland among others.

However, procrastination has been the only inner force controlling most people. The people above did not just achieve their height by "miracle", but they refused to say "tomorrow", they acted towards their dreams everyday of their lives.

Winning the war against procrastination requires only one weapon known as ACTION, my dear brothers and sisters, by now you should be taking a decision, starting a project, making a move, seizing opportunities and fulfilling your dreams BUT you must act NOW!

According to Micheal E. Angier -"Ideas are worthless. Intentions have no power. Plans are nothing......unless they are followed with action. Do it now!"

If your dream is to become a writer, start writing, if your dream is to become a musician, start singing, if it is your passion to become an entrepreneur start creating, start taking the risk, start following your passion. JUST START ACTING.

Be an actor of today, not an actor of tomorrow
